WebThree children die each week in Scotland from an incurable condition. We aim to deliver world-class care for children who die young, and their families. The number of babies, … WebThere are more than 16,700 babies, children and young people (aged 0-21) across Scotland who may die from a life-shortening condition. In Scotland there is a single-national provider of children’s hospice care, with CHAS working across hospices, hospitals and children’s homes.
